July 31 ,1987 , inDüsseldorf ,West Germany ) is a Germanice hockey player of Polish decent. He is 6 ft 2 in tall, weighs 176 lb, shoots left and plays left wing. Despite being born in Dusseldorf. He chose to play forKölner Haie of the DEL arch rivals of his hometwon team DEG Metro Stars of Dusseldorf. Gogulla wears the jersey number 87 due to the year of his birth.Gogulla was drafted in the second round, 48th overall, by the
Buffalo Sabres in the2005 NHL Entry Draft . Gogulla signed an entry-level contact with the Buffalo Sabres on June 1 2007, to prevent them from re-entering the NHL entry draft in 2007, although there was some confusion as to whether had signed. NHL rules state prospects must be signed before 5:00pm EDT on June 1 or the team's rights to the player expire and he is free to re-enter the draft or become a free agent. Gogulla was signed by this deadline, but the contract had to be approved by the NHL. There was a delay in the approval process meaning the deal could not be announced and so it was assumed that the management had failed to sign Gogulla in time. On June 2 2007, the deal was approved and announced as a three-year entry-level contract.Gogulla is playing in his native Germany for the first year of his contract and will have a choice of playing in Germany or North America for the second year of the contract. This will likely be determined by his performance at the preseason training camp. If he makes the NHL roster out of camp, he will remain in the North America for the year and may spend time in the Sabres' AHL affiliate. The third year will be played in North America in a similar scenario. These unusual terms of the contract are likely what caused the delay, combined with the fact that it is a naturally busy deadline day.
Gogulla played for Germany at the
2007 World Junior Ice Hockey Championships getting a team-leading 6 assists in the tournament. Gogulla represented Germany at the2007 IIHF World Championship scoring 5 assists.Career statistics
